    Religiosity, political tolerance, and willingness to reconcile in post-conflict contexts:Evidence from Colombia

    No full text
    This article examines the role of religiosity in shaping people’s willingness to reconcile with ex-combatants in post-conflict societies, using Colombia as a case study. Drawing on LAPOP survey data from 2014 to 2018, the study employs linear and logistic regression models to reveal that individuals tend to be less willing to reconcile when they have high levels of religiosity (LAPOP 2004–2021). However, this relation can be mitigated by an individual’s level of political tolerance, which fosters greater openness to support reconciliation despite strong religious convictions

    The once and future tree:Ontic space, the anthropocene, and the Sycamore Gap

    No full text
    The felling of the iconic tree at the Sycamore Gap in Northumberland, England, in September 2023 was met with national outrage. The tree was believed to be over 300 years old and was the subject of countless paintings, photographs, and social media posts, earning it the moniker of "most photographed tree in Britain". The reaction to this act of vandalism went beyond expectation, with locals describing the loss as akin to a wound on the soul of the community. Mourners far and wide expressed similar outpourings of grief. In this paper, we explore how the natural world relates to questions of ontological security. We argue that the destruction of nature represents a violation of our sense of "home."However, we also explore how the persistent dualism of human and nonhuman in Western thought is an ontological security mechanism. The Sycamore Gap Tree is a perfect distillation of this, as much of the media coverage has "untreed"the tree to such a degree that it is no longer part of the "natural"world but rather a part of the British "home"and national story. Stories of what the tree "saw"and "felt"dominated the news cycle. In presenting the tree as part of "our world,"these narratives reinforce a fundamental narrative of human ontological security in opposition to the natural world.</p

    Juxtaposed trajectories:Weird relations, temporality, and life in Lake Salda and Jezero Crater

    No full text
    Conceived as an analog environment to early Mars, Lake Salda, a large, shallow tectonic lake located in southwestern Turkey, known for its stunningly clear azure waters, white sands, and unique geomorphological formations, is one of the few known lakes on Earth that scientists believe contain carbonates and depositional features like those found at the Jezero Crater on Mars. Between 2020 and 2021, NASA’s geobiologists studied microbial fossils in Lake Salda to prepare for the Mars 2020 Perseverance mission, which aimed to search for ancient life on Mars. This extended photo essay pushes against dichotomies of familiar and alien, relation and separation, past and present, in order to trace the weird encounters and disjointed temporalities that characterize the biogeological and geopolitical relations and separations between Mars and Earth. In doing so, the essay points at the impossibility of working through a logic of past/present, geological/astronomical, and familiar/alien dichotomies, and a cosmic demand for facing ambiguity and disjointed, even anachronistic temporalities when it comes to non-anthropocentric imagination about life and living on other planets. In the disjointed temporal, political, and biogeological relations, or modes of time-telling between Salda and Jezero, where agnostic musings over life and anachronistic political relations might flourish, we might find weird openings. The juxtaposed trajectories of the blue and red planets force us to confront our assumptions regarding life and non-life, past and present, possible and impossible.</p

    Impact on diabetes-related health outcomes using a digitally-enabled diabetes self-management platform in Somerset, UK: An interrupted time-series analysis

    No full text
    Background: The MyWay Diabetes (MWD) digital platform aims to improve diabetes management through personalisedaccess to health records, structured education, and other self-management features.Purpose: We aimed to assess health outcomes in MWD users with type 1 diabetes (T1DM) and type 2 diabetes(T2DM) over 6 years of use.Methods: An interrupted time-series analysis in MWD users with T1DM or T2DM in Somerset, UK, compared preandpost-MWD registration trends to estimate differences in health outcomes (HbA1c, blood pressure, lipids,BMI, weight). Generalised estimating equations modelling adjusted for participant baseline characteristics andidentified significant predictors.Results: A total of 7207 people (T1DM: n = 750 (52.3 % female, mean age 51.2 (SD15.8)), T2DM: n = 6457(58.1 % male, mean age 64.7 (SD12.0))) were included in the analysis. The study showed some health outcomesimproved significantly for T2DM between pre- and post-MWD registration. HbA1c reduced by 8.6 mmol/mol at24 months post-MWD registration, with greatest improvements observed in users who were younger, had shorterdiabetes durations and who were frequent MWD users. All health outcomes for T1DM were unchanged.Conclusion: The large HbA1c reduction for T2DM is notable for a scalable digitally-enabled self-managementintervention and adds to the evidence base for digital interventions for diabetes self-management

    Human factors barriers to retrofitting historic residential properties in Edinburgh

    No full text
    Edinburgh has one of the highest concentrations of historic buildings in the UK outside of London, with more than 10,000 listed buildings and 50 conservation areas where modifications of properties are restricted for heritage conservation purposes. Like many cities, Edinburgh also has an ambitious net zero aspiration to significantly reduce average household electricity and gas consumption, which necessitates changes that may not be permitted in protected properties. This paper examines the interlinked human factor challenges to retrofitting protected historic residential properties in Edinburgh, using data from a 2023 City of Edinburgh Council public consultation on building heritage conservation and climate change adaptation. The results showed that whilst financial cost is a major barrier for historic property-owners to improve the energy efficiency and climate change resilience of their homes (as indicated by 70% of all respondents), other human factors in the planning process and wider construction industry also contribute to the larger national challenge of retrofitting and adapting the historic building stock. These barriers contribute to Edinburgh residents’ overall negative perception of retrofitting or adapting historic residential properties, and an erosion of trust of the local authority, leading to both potential loss of heritage architectural characteristics and lagging rate of old buildings needing energy retrofits

    Overlapping structural and functional connectivity disruptions in clinical high-risk for psychosis participants:A network analysis study

    No full text
    Schizophrenia involves aberrant connectivity of anatomical and functional networks. However, it is currently unclear whether such disruptions are present in clinical high-risk for psychosis (CHR-P) participants and whether there may be an overlap between structural and functional connectivity alterations. We obtained diffusion magnetic resonance imaging (dMRI) and resting-state, magnetic resonance imaging (rsfMRI) data from N = 110 CHR-P participants and N = 49 healthy controls (HC). A network analysis approach was employed to explore differences in dMRI and rsfMRI connectivity as well as potential overlap between both modalities. In addition, correlations between dMRI and rsfMRI-data, clinical and neurocognitive variables as well as with clinical outcomes were investigated. We observed hyper- and hypoconnectivity across occipital, parietal, temporal, and frontal cortices in both dMRI and rsfMRI-data in CHR-Ps. Moreover, dMRI- and rsfMRI-defined overlapping nodes that differed between CHR-Ps vs. HC overlapped with visual networks, right ventral attention network, and right default mode network. Correlational analyses indicated significant relationships between the severity of CHR-P symptoms, cognitive deficits, and dMRI/rsfMRI-defined hypo- and hyper-connectivity. Finally, CHR-P individuals with persistent attenuated psychotic symptoms (APS) were characterised by aberrant dMRI and rsfMRI connectivity compared to non-persistent APS. Our study shows subtle but widespread disruptions in dMRI and rsfMRI connectivity in CHR-P participants. Specifically, we identified several occipital, parietal, temporal, and frontal regions that were characterised by hyper and hypoconnectivity which correlated with the severity of clinical symptoms and cognitive impairments. Moreover, our findings suggest that dMRI and rsfMRI connectivity measures could serve as a potential biomarker for clinical outcomes in CHR-Ps.</p

    The association between disordered eating and sleep in non-clinical population:A systematic review and meta-analysis

    Get PDF
    Sleep and disordered eating behaviours may be linked through physiological and psychological mechanisms; yet, no review has systematically investigated the relationship between different sleep indicators and disordered eating behaviours and cognitions outside a clinical context. The present systematic review and meta-analysis addressed this research gap to gain a better understanding of associations in non-clinical populations to potentially inform future prevention and early intervention approaches in the context of both sleep and disordered eating. All studies published from 2003 onwards were included if they assessed a relationship between disordered eating and sleep in a non-clinical population. In total, 89 studies were included, of which 33 met eligibility criteria for the meta-analyses. General eating pathology, loss of control eating, and excessive exercise were most consistently significantly associated with poorer sleep quality and higher insomnia symptoms, while evening chronotypes were most consistently associated with bulimia symptoms, night eating, and body image concerns. Likely due to the limited evidence available, findings relating to restrictive eating behaviours and bulimia symptoms were largely mixed. Primarily small and non-significant effects were found for associations between disordered eating and sleep duration measures. Overall, this review identified a need for more longitudinal research, the use of validated assessment methods, and studies focusing on restrictive eating, bulimia-related behaviours, and excessive exercise. Despite the heterogeneity of study populations and designs, this review highlights sleep problems (e.g., insomnia symptoms, impaired sleep quality) as a transdiagnostic correlate of disordered eating concerns

    Using multi-method data for more accurate research findings

    Get PDF
    The vast majority of personality research is based on a single method: self-reports. As about half of the variance in single-method trait scores is the result of systematic biases and random error, it is likely that most research findings are biased, even well-replicated ones. While some ‘significant’ associations may be entirely artefactual, most are likely to be underestimated, sometimes by as much as 50 %. Unfortunately, this is rarely discussed explicitly, let alone addressed empirically. After explaining the causes and extent of the problem, we argue that it can be effectively addressed by combining personality trait self-ratings with those of knowledgeable informants. To underscore the feasibility of multi-method research, we review recent large-scale studies that have combined self-reports and informant reports to provide more accurate answers to key questions in personality research, such as the heritability of traits and their association with important life outcomes. Since most associations are likely to be underestimated in typical single-method studies, multi-method studies will likely reveal higher correlations with commensurately stronger theoretical and practical implications. For example, single-method studies may have underestimated heritability by around a third and the predictability of life satisfaction from personality traits by around half. Personality psychologists have made great progress in incentivizing more reliable research; it is now time for the field to incentivize valid research, too

    My whole world:Integrating the digital into social work assessments with children and young people

    Get PDF
    Most children and young people now live a significant proportion of their lives online, a situation that has been accelerated by the COVID-19 pandemic which required many services, including education, to go online. Social media apps, messaging apps, online gaming, and chatrooms provide new and important spaces for children and young people to connect to others, have fun and learn. Equally, children and young people also have upsetting and harmful experiences online, with research raising particular concerns about the number of young people accessing distressing images and/or pornographic material online, and experiencing bullying and sexual exploitation online. Despite this complex picture of online risk and opportunity, little guidance exists for social work practitioners about how to incorporate the digital world into a holistic assessment of children’s needs and strengths. This article begins to address this gap by exploring the key elements of assessing a child’s digital world, bringing in learning from guidance available in England, current research and good practice in terms of assessment. The discussion is focused around three domains: how the child or young person is growing and developing; what the child or young person needs from the people who look after them, and the impact of the child or young person’s wider world or family, friends and community. Each of these domains are considered in turn, with suggestions given about how the digital world might be incorporated into this ‘triangle’ of domains and how current research might help practitioners to think about what they need to find out and why

    Does noise pollution influence modal choices? A random forest application

    Get PDF
    This work investigates the relationship between noise pollution and modal choices exploring and comparing two different urban contexts: Greater London and Brisbane. To achieve this, data on commuting flows by mode of transport and estimated noise pollution have been obtained and combined with measures to characterise the built environment which demonstrated to have an influence on modal choices. Random forest models have shown very good performances in solving classification problems to predict transport modes and allow the exploration of non-linear relationships between the predicted classes and explanatory variables. Two random forest models have been tuned, trained and tested to investigate the association between modal choices and contextual variables, including noise pollution, in Greater London and Brisbane. Results have shown that noise levels play a role in predicting modal choices in Greater London, while the characteristics of the built environment are more relevant when predicting modal choices in Brisbane. Furthermore, we find that walking and cycling, despite being both active travel modes, are influenced by very different factors, with cycling displaying patterns more similar to those characterising driving. Evidence showing the varying relationships between walking and cycling with contextual variables, e.g. noise levels, building and street density, presence of amenities can inform more targeted policies to encourage active travel.</p
